Soderling battles to first win of the year

February 09, 2010

Sweden's Robin Soderling put an indifferent start to the year behind him by beating Frenchman Florent Serra 4-6, 6-4, 6-1 in the first round of the World Indoor Tournament on Monday.

Soderling, the world number eight, suffered first round exits in Chennai and at the Australian Open but got off the mark with a battling display in Rotterdam.

"I hadn't played for some weeks and today I also had a bad start but I fought my way back into the match," third-seed Soderling told reporters.

"I am satisfied with the win but can and have to do much better," he added.

Fifth seed Tommy Robredo, who also experienced a first round exit in Melbourne last month, overcame Dutch wild card Robin Haase 7-6, 6-4.

Top seed Novak Djokovic faces Ukrainian Sergiy Stakhovsky on Tuesday.
